首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

域名打不开网站ip能打开网页

域名打不开网站,IP能打开网页

基础概念

域名(Domain Name)是互联网上用于识别和定位计算机的字符型地址,它通过DNS(Domain Name System,域名系统)解析为对应的IP地址。当用户在浏览器中输入域名时,浏览器会向DNS服务器请求解析该域名对应的IP地址,然后通过该IP地址访问网站。

可能的原因及解决方法

  1. DNS解析问题
    • 原因:DNS服务器可能无法正确解析域名,或者DNS缓存出现问题。
    • 解决方法
      • 清除本地DNS缓存:在命令提示符(Windows)或终端(Linux/Mac)中运行 ipconfig/flushdns(Windows)或 sudo systemd-resolve --flush-caches(Linux)。
      • 更换DNS服务器:可以尝试使用Google的公共DNS(8.8.8.8和8.8.4.4)或其他可靠的DNS服务。
  • 域名配置问题
    • 原因:域名注册信息或DNS记录配置错误。
    • 解决方法
      • 检查域名注册信息,确保域名指向正确的服务器IP地址。
      • 登录域名注册商的管理面板,检查DNS记录是否正确配置,特别是A记录和CNAME记录。
  • 服务器配置问题
    • 原因:服务器可能未正确配置以响应域名请求。
    • 解决方法
      • 确保服务器上的Web服务器(如Apache、Nginx)配置正确,能够响应域名请求。
      • 检查服务器防火墙设置,确保80端口(HTTP)和443端口(HTTPS)开放。
  • 网络问题
    • 原因:可能是本地网络或ISP(Internet Service Provider)网络问题。
    • 解决方法
      • 尝试使用其他网络(如移动数据网络)访问域名,排除本地网络问题。
      • 联系ISP,了解是否存在网络故障。

应用场景

  • 网站访问:用户在浏览器中输入域名访问网站时。
  • 邮件服务:邮件客户端通过域名访问邮件服务器。

相关优势

  • 便捷性:用户可以通过易于记忆的域名访问网站,而不需要记住复杂的IP地址。
  • 灵活性:通过DNS解析,可以轻松更改网站服务器的IP地址,而不影响用户访问。

示例代码

以下是一个简单的DNS解析示例代码(Python):

代码语言:txt
复制
import socket

def resolve_domain(domain):
    try:
        ip = socket.gethostbyname(domain)
        print(f"The IP address of {domain} is {ip}")
    except socket.gaierror as e:
        print(f"Failed to resolve {domain}: {e}")

resolve_domain("example.com")

参考链接

通过以上方法,您可以逐步排查并解决域名打不开网站的问题。如果问题依然存在,建议联系专业的技术支持团队进行进一步诊断。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

GitHub 打不开 or 打开慢,这个工具搞定!

ip地址,获取最佳网络速度 不用特殊的上网方法也能解决一些网站和库无法访问或访问速度慢的问题 建议遇到打开比较慢的国外网站,可以优先尝试将该域名添加到dns设置中 DNS解析过慢,从github.com...获取IP的时间过久,这个应该是GitHub访问速度慢的主要原因。...通常的解决办法就是查询github.com的ip地址,手动修改Hosts文件,不经过DNS服务器解析。 当然这里有个比较大的缺点,就是IP会有更新,这样每次都需要手动去进行修改。...智能解析github.com的最佳ip地址,获取最佳的网络速度。 当然不止GitHub这个网站,其他网站也可尝试添加。 添加了stackoverflow这个网址,一个国外编程人员交流的网站。...2、请求拦截 拦截打不开网站,代理到加速镜像站点上去 可配置多个镜像站作为备份 具备测速机制,当访问失败或超时之后,自动切换到备用站点,使得目标服务高可用 可以使用加速镜像站点,GitHub的镜像网站目前小

2K10
  • 怎么查看网站域名域名ip有什么区别?

    域名是我们使用网络时经常听到的词汇,它是网页的名称,通过域名我们可以直接访问网页,一般域名都是由一连串分隔开来的名字组成,可以是数字也可以是英文或中文。...不过一般人并不会去特意关注网站域名,所以也不清楚怎么查看网站域名,下面就让我给大家简单介绍一下吧。 image.png 怎么查看网站域名?...域名ip有什么区别? 很久以前其实没有域名,因为主机不多,大家只要ip地址就可以访问网页。但是随着时代的发展,ip很显然不够用了,为了用户们能够更加方便直接的访问网页,于是乎就出现了域名。...域名可以有很多,大大满足了用户们的需求。大家可以通过域名访问网页,也不需要再去记录复杂的ip地址。域名ip最大的区别就是,ip只有一个,但是域名可以有很多。...但大部分情况下,现如今的域名都是一对多关系。 怎么查看网站域名相信大家已明了,想要查看网站域名按照上述步骤就可以了。

    12.6K10

    域名被墙了怎么处理?怎样做才能快速解封?

    现在的网站管理十分严格,域名中如何涉及敏感词汇或者敏感词汇很容易被网络屏蔽,结果就是无法访问页面,很多朋友都在询问,域名被墙了怎么处理?怎样做才能快速解封?...当网站启动时间较长或者响应时间长,也会出现无法访问的现象,因此首先要辨别网络连接是否正确。 image.png IP被纳入黑名单 查看域名后发现IP被纳入黑名单,域名被墙了怎么处理?...一般来说,域名绑定国外IP被墙的概率很大,如果发现网页打不开,说明国内的服务器不支持这个关联设置,请专业的VPN代理就能解决,如果IP被封锁,换一个服务器空间或者换一个主机的服务商,网络也实现正常访问...另一种可能是域名间接性被屏蔽,比如上午还能访问网页,下午便无法打开,通常遇到这样的情况不算难处理,找到被屏蔽的敏感词汇,然后进行修改或者删除,间接性被墙的问题就能得到解决,因此网页如果一时间打不开切勿着急下判断...IP被纳入黑名单以及域名间接性被屏蔽的处理方式就介绍到这,网站一旦被墙会留下记录痕迹,涉及到的敏感词汇被修改后仍旧存在被墙的可能,如果担心被拦截的风险,建议企业或个人重新注册域名并制作网站

    7.1K20

    如何解析域名 com域名与cn域名有什么区别

    大家在网上浏览的网页都有各自的域名,而域名只是为了方便用户的记忆,浏览器是不记域名的,只记IP地址。...而IP地址是一连串的数字字母,很难让用户记住,于是就有了相对应的转换过程,将IP数值转换成用户易于记忆的域名,但域名的访问还需要做解析。下面就给大家讲讲如何解析域名?...如果是要进行WWW域名访问的,就要加上www别名记录,也可以加上@别名记录,两者之间做个301重定向就好。解析完成之后,就能打开域名,访问网站了。如果在解析过程遇到什么问题,要提交工单问客服。...com域名与cn域名有什么区别 首先要知道,com域名是国际顶级域名后缀,也是全球使用最为广泛的域名后缀,在国内也有很多人愿意选用这个com域名国际范一点。...以上就是关于如何解析域名的教程,如果在完成解析后,确定填写的IP值没有错误,但依旧打不开网站,不要着急,可能是后台在缓冲,稍等一会之后再打开访问。如果依旧打不开网站,就要问客服是什么问题。

    19.8K20

    访问80端口的网页报错 This page can‘t be displayed 解决过程小记

    今天接到某城商行北京分行的网站开发同事求助,故障很简单:网站是个静态页面 ,webserver安装的IBM 的IHS,IHS配置一切妥当后通过客户端浏览器无法访问 访问80端口的网页报错 This...在web服务器上curl ip:80访问拿到首页数据 基础检查做一遍之后就感觉这不是一般故障,平复一下心情之后开始排除故障: 排除一下端口问题: 把ihs80端口改为81,浏览器访问域名是可以正常打开页面的...故障是一样的,打不开页面报错依旧。 ? 看来只要是用80端口网页打不开,九成把我可以确定跟服务器配置是没关系的,这位网工同事就在旁边,表示不服。 好,一会再打你脸。...都已经配置好了,就试一下吧,curl竟然是正常拿到首页数据的,果断安装一个火狐浏览器,用浏览器也打开页面,真是奇怪了,难到只有linux客户端可以访问?...再换个IP,改成10.10.10.17,又意外的打开网站页面。 原来是给我的10.10.10.18的IP是被策略阻止访问80端口的! 果断甩锅!

    3.3K50

    DNS是什么?有什么用?

    重点来了,我们电脑浏览器在访问百度网站的时候,会把我们输入的域名,先交给域名服务器也就是DNS来查询百度网站服务器的IP地址,然后DNS把IP地址传送给浏览器,浏览器通过IP地址就访问到百度网站了。...如果你明白DNS是什么,这个问题就很简单了,我们的电脑如果没有指定DNS服务器,或者被流氓软件篡改了,那浏览器在访问网站的时候,就没办法找到网站IP地址,除非我们直接在浏览器上输入网站IP地址才能访问...DNS被篡改或者没有指定,不能在浏览器输入域名访问网站,那我为什么可以上QQ和微信呢? 因为这两个软件中都直接指定了服务器的IP地址,没有通过域名通信,所以软件能用,而网站打不开咯。 ? ?...又有人要问了,在平常工作中,有时候会遇到客户发来的网站地址, 客户打开这个网站,而自己却无法访问,自己也打开其他网站, 这又是怎么一回事呢?...DNS服务器如果出问题的话,就会影响我们打开网站慢或者直接打不开,甚至把我们带到一些恶意网站,病毒网站。所以使用一个优质的DNS就很有必要了。

    9.8K31

    DNS如何解析服务器

    这就是DNS服务器,DNS服务器有着相当全的域名IP,当你输入一串网站的时候,这串网站并不会直接访问,而是先将这个网站发送给DNS服务器,DNS服务器帮你把这串网站变成了IP地址,然后返回给你的电脑,...你再访问这个IP地址,这样就解决了IP难记,而域名不能直接访问的问题了。...所以这样就可以解释文章开头那个故障了,你打不开网页,却可以上QQ,因为上QQ不需要涉及到DNS解析服务,直接访问的就是腾讯服务器的IP,但是你打开网页输入的是域名,而你的DNS服务器输入错误或者DNS服务器炸了...,所以你电脑不知道这串域名对应的IP,你自然就没法访问这个网站,而如果你手动直接输入IP,你依旧是可以访问网站的。

    13.6K10

    如何解决网站启用https后提示重定向过多,网页打不开的问题?

    前几天有个站长在网站配置SSL证书的时候有出现故障,提示重定向过多,导致网站打不开。...不至于配置个SSL证书需要修改网站配置文件,因为WordPress程序更新这么频繁肯定支持的,所以我们默认只需要将网站网址修改成https即可,这里我们可以到数据库中修改,如果网站在确认可以打开的时候可以到后台设置...这里这位站长朋友打不开网站,我只能去数据库中配置。 然后再检查其配置文件,尤其是Nginx的配置文件估计问题在这里。通过检测nginx -t检测是有报错的,看来问题就在这里。...最后重启服务器再重新确认一下配置文件没有问题,打开网站肯定也就没有问题。...如果你还不明白可以去参考下菜鸟站长之家的网站www.cnzzzj.com 另外主要注意是 在安装网站运行环境时,尽力编译安装完整版,切勿图快。

    4.3K40

    【网络】网络知识科普篇

    ,我问他啥网址啊,我一看也正常啊,不会被墙掉,我完全可以快速打开,我远程他电脑发现是可以打开的,但是很慢很慢,我就检查他家的网络,其他网页打开很快,后来我问他家啥宽带,他说之前家里人无脑办的免费的移动宽带...,打游戏延迟简直就是460,我听到这,好了应该是解析服务器的锅,有时候大内网分配的解析服务器会有点问题 解决办法:我给他改了阿里的公共DNS(223.5.5.5),完美解决,打开刚刚那个网页速度贼快 相信大家都知道...114查号台吧,DNS可以理解为114查号台,类似中间处理环节 下面我们来详细解释下,假如说你打开百度(www.baidu.com),但是电脑不认识这个,这是域名,电脑并不会直接找到这个地址,这时候DNS...这个一般适用于动态ip搭建网站(大内网ip,可以通过特殊手段来玩,这里不赘述这个深层的东西了) 下面我们来解释下,宽带运营商一般提供的ip地址会变化,这个时间并不能确定,当你建设个人站做映射到自己家的服务器...(或者电脑,一般是大佬的操作)这个ip一直更换会导致域名映射到错误的ip地址上,导致个人站打不开,这个ddns会捕捉变更的ip地址,重新映射 DHCP 中文名:动态主机配置协议 常用于内网(路由器后台或许可以找到

    3K30

    【网络】DNS,域名解析系统

    域名解析系统 DNS 是一个应用层协议,也可以认为是一套系统,域名解析系统 域名就是网址,域名代表了 IP 地址 域名IP 地址,存在着对应关系,一般是一个域名对应一个或者多个 IP,也可能是多个域名对应一个...现在已经不使用了(虽然仍然有效),因为网站太多了,域名IP 地址都有很多,靠文件来维护,就很不方便 DNS 服务器 为了解决上述问题,就搭建了 DNS 服务器,就把 hosts 文件放到 DNS 服务器里...当某个电脑需要进行域名解析,就访问 DNS 服务器 镜像服务器 全世界有这么多的设备上网,每时每刻都在访问 DNS 服务器,DNS 服务器顶住这么大的访问量吗?...每个人上网的时候,就会就近访问 DNS 服务器 qq/wx 打开网页打不开,就是 DNS 挂了 所谓高并发问题,千万不要想的太复杂,核心思路就两条: 开源,搭建 DNS 的大佬们,就号召各个网络运营商...就需要约定以某个服务器的数据为基准,一旦有变更,就修改这个基准服务器的数据,其他服务器从基准的服务器同步数据,基准服务器称为“根服务器” 某个地区的 DNS 镜像可能会很出现故障(qq/wx 能上,但是网页打不开

    10210

    一分钟解决打不开网页的故障

    本文讲述的是一个非常多见的问题——微信和QQ正常收发消息,但是所有网页打不开,这个问题具有一定的普遍性和高发性,所以,我也是再一次地发文讲述。...,ping通,说明IP配置正确、DNS解析没问题、网络通讯也没问题,ping哪个网址无所谓,其实就是检测DNS解析能力是否正常; 第三步,打开浏览器验证一下问题所在,果然打不开网页; 第四步,检查代理服务器设置...直接在“搜索”中输入“代理”,打开代理服务器设置,看到代理地址为127.0.0.1,后面是58XXX端口号,嘿嘿,原来是翻墙了,然而翻墙软件关闭后,代理设置没有还原或者关闭,那自然是打不开网页了。...在日常IT外包工作中,见得更多的打不开网页的问题,就是DNS劫持,ipconfig /all命令,能看到DNS服务器被设置为莫名其妙的IP地址了,所以网页打不开了。...原理分析:通过浏览器打开网页的时候,当你输入网址后,该请求会转发给你所设置的DNS服务器,DNS服务器收到请求后,看自己能否把网址解析为IP地址,如果,就把IP回复到你电脑,然后浏览器就以IP地址和网站服务器交互通讯了

    14410

    如何去除烦人的垃圾广告

    ,再次打开天涯帖子,发现页面广告不见了。 ? 除了去除网页广告,它还有个实用功能就是去除视频广告,比如腾讯,优酷,爱奇艺这样的影视网站,开头广告 45秒这还算短的,我见过120秒的广告 。 ?...想去广告就买会员吧,我也不经常上这几个网站,会员就没必要买了。 ? 安装好这个扩展后再次打开爱奇艺可以看到广告一晃而过就开始播放视频,而且视频中的广告也能去了,我录制了个GIF。 ?...修改 hosts hosts 是一个系统文件,它将域名IP 相关联,访问一个域名的时候,系统会先在hosts 文件寻找对应的 IP 地址,如果找到了就打开对应的ip,所以如果我们手动修改ip为127.0.0.1...,这样域名就没法打开了,比如618的时候搜狗输入法弹广告,可以在hosts加上下面这段,弹窗广告就出不来了。...有人整理了很多网站的广告域名,添加这些到hosts文件就能去广告了 https://raw.githubusercontent.com/jdlingyu/ad-wars/master/hosts ?

    2.1K30

    GitHub经常打不开或者访问慢究极解决方法,真实有效哦!

    由于github.com网站位于美国旧金山,所以初始访问GitHub时网络寻址会比较耗费时间,这也是网站打开速度慢的其中一个原因!...最初用户从浏览器中输入github.com网址时,浏览器并不知道这个域名对应的真实ip地址,先问问自己电脑认识不认识这个域名的门牌号,如果本机不认识会接着往上问,当地运营商也不认识这个域名的话,继续问上级...所以,如果我们直接告诉浏览器目的地,那么浏览器也就不会一步一步去费劲问路了,这在一定程度上也就优化了访问网站的速度。 正常来说,网站的主域名下会存在多个子域名,由这些域名组合在一起提供完整的服务。...1.查询DNS解析地址 这里我们用站长工具DNS查询 选择TTL值最小的ip:52.69.186.44 ?...直接ping官网得到低至59ms的延迟,可以看出来这效果非常不错了。 版权声明:本站原创文章 GitHub经常打不开或者访问慢究极解决方法,真实有效哦! 由 小维 发表!

    44.5K43

    cdn是什么意思?cdn如何使用?

    平时浏览网页的时候内容是越来越多的,这就会造成用户们打开网页速度过慢或者打不开的问题,相信很多人都是听说过cdn这个网页加速方式,那么cdn是什么意思?cdn如何使用?...属于一种智能化的虚拟网络,是建立在现有网络的基础之上的,依靠的并不是实体服务器而是分布在各个地方的边缘服务器,通过特殊的方式将用户们需要获取的内容呈现出来,降低网络访问过程中的堵塞,从而加快用户们访问网页的速度...cdn加速服务并不是免费使用的,大家在注册域名的时候就可以找到这项服务,那么cdn如何使用呢?...cdn的使用方法非常简单,现在市面上的各大域名服务商都为用户们提供了cdn加速服务,在域名服务商找到cdn服务之后就可以选择购买套餐,根据实际的需求购买成功后将域名IP地址添加上去就可以了。...关于cdn如何使用的文章内容今天就介绍到这里,相信大家对于cdn这项服务已经有所了解了,现在很多网站都会选择购买另外的cdn加速服务,相对来说性价比还是蛮高的,对于网站的流量提升有很大帮助。

    4.9K20
    领券